Applications and Tested Dilutions

Application Tested Dilution
Western Blot (WB) 1 µg/mL
ELISA 1:50,000

Product Specifications

Specification Description
Species Reactivity Human
Host / Isotype Rabbit / IgG
Class Polyclonal
Type Antibody
Immunogen Affinity purified Anti-HSF1 antibody prepared from whole rabbit serum produced by repeated immunizations with a synthetic peptide near the N-terminal portion of human HSF1 protein.
Conjugate Unconjugated
Form Liquid
Concentration 1 mg/mL
Purification Affinity chromatography
Storage Buffer 0.02 M potassium phosphate, pH 7.2, with 0.15 M NaCl
Contains 0.01% sodium azide
Storage Conditions -20°C, avoid freeze/thaw cycles
Shipping Conditions Ambient (domestic); Wet ice (international)

Product Specific Information

Store vial at -20°C prior to opening. Aliquot contents and freeze at -20°C or below for extended storage. Avoid cycles of freezing and thawing. Centrifuge product if not completely clear after standing at room temperature. This product is stable for several weeks at 4°C as an undiluted liquid. Dilute only prior to immediate use.

Anti-HSF1 is directed against human HSF1 at an N-terminus position. A BLAST analysis suggests reactivity with this protein in mouse and bovine species based on 100% homology for the immunogen sequence.

Target Information

All organisms respond to elevated temperatures and various environmental stresses by rapid synthesis of heat shock RNAs and proteins. The regulation of heat shock gene transcription is mediated by the transcriptional activator heat shock factor (HSF), which binds to heat shock response elements (HSEs). These HSEs consist of three repeats of a 5-nucleotide {nGAAn} module arranged in alternating orientation and present upstream of all heat shock genes.

The HSEs are highly conserved among species, yet HSF purified from yeast, Drosophila, and human have different molecular weights and do not show significant immunological cross-reaction. Two HSFs have been identified in human cells, HSF1 and HSF2, which bind to the same HSEs and have 38% sequence identity. These factors are activated by distinct stimuli: HSF1 responds to classical stress signals such as heat, heavy metals, and oxidative reagents, whereas HSF2 is activated during hemin-mediated differentiation of human erythroleukemia cells.

HSF1 exists constitutively in the cytoplasm and nucleus of unstressed cells as a monomer lacking DNA binding activity. Upon stress, HSF1 becomes activated to a nuclear localized, trimeric state that binds DNA. Phosphorylation of HSF1 is necessary for maximal transcription of heat shock genes.
